extinguishing panel customized production

Extinguishing panel customized production represents a cutting-edge approach to fire safety system manufacturing, delivering tailored solutions that meet specific facility requirements and safety standards. This specialized production process encompasses the design, engineering, and assembly of fire control panels that seamlessly integrate with existing safety infrastructure. Each panel is meticulously crafted to accommodate unique spatial constraints, operational requirements, and regulatory compliance needs. The production process incorporates advanced microprocessor technology, enabling sophisticated monitoring capabilities and rapid response times to potential fire threats. These customized panels feature programmable logic controllers, multiple zone monitoring capabilities, and compatibility with various suppression agents. The systems are equipped with intuitive user interfaces, facilitating easy operation and maintenance while providing comprehensive status displays and alarm notifications. The production process ensures each panel undergoes rigorous quality control testing, including simulation of various emergency scenarios to verify proper functionality. These panels can be integrated with building management systems, security networks, and emergency response protocols, creating a cohesive safety infrastructure that protects both assets and occupants.

Advanced Integration Capabilities

The customized production process excels in creating panels with superior integration capabilities, setting new standards in fire safety system connectivity. These panels are engineered with open architecture protocols that enable seamless communication with various building management systems, security networks, and emergency response systems. The integration extends beyond basic connectivity, incorporating intelligent algorithms that enable coordinated responses across multiple systems. This sophisticated integration allows for automated emergency protocols, such as HVAC system control, access control management, and elevator operations during fire events. The panels support multiple communication protocols, including ModBus, BACnet, and proprietary systems, ensuring compatibility with existing infrastructure. This level of integration significantly enhances overall building safety while streamlining system management and reducing operational complexity.

Intelligent Monitoring and Control

The customized panels incorporate state-of-the-art monitoring and control features that revolutionize fire safety management. Each panel is equipped with advanced sensors and processing capabilities that provide real-time system status monitoring and intelligent alarm verification. The control systems utilize adaptive algorithms that can differentiate between false alarms and genuine threats, significantly reducing unnecessary system activations. The monitoring capabilities extend to component-level diagnostics, providing detailed information about system health and performance. These panels feature intuitive touch-screen interfaces that display comprehensive system information and allow for easy configuration changes. The control systems support multiple access levels with secure authentication, ensuring that only authorized personnel can modify critical settings.
